Sherburne County awards 2025 official-publication contracts to Elk River Star News and Patriot News

The board awarded four official-publication line items for 2025 to competing local newspapers after staff reviewed bid rates and circulation coverage.

Sherburne County commissioners approved contract awards for the county’s 2025 official publications, selecting between two bidders based on column-inch pricing and coverage. Staff presented bids received from the Elk River Star News and the Patriot News and recommended awards by line item.

For the delinquent tax list, the board awarded the contract to the Elk River Star News at $3.38 per column inch; commissioners noted the paper is subscription-based but its online display of notices is accessible without charge. For the primary financial statement printing, the Patriot News was awarded the work at $17 per column inch (Elk River had not submitted a competitive bid for that specific line item). The board awarded the summarized/alternate financial-statement publication to the Elk River Star News at $12 per column inch. For county commissioner proceedings (minutes/official proceedings), the Elk River Star News received the award at $3.19 per column inch.

Staff explained that both papers qualify as official newspapers under Minnesota rules and that published notices for the county would be available in the free/accessible portions of the Elk River Star News online platform even where the paper maintains paid subscriptions. Commissioners discussed circulation and geographic coverage — Patriot News covers several zip codes on one side of the county, while the Elk River Star News has a large online following (staff cited roughly 54,914 active users as of November in the packet). The board voted to award each line item as presented.
